A solution of NaOH(aq) contains 7.4 g of NaOH(s) per 100.0 mL of solution. Calculate the pH and the pOH of the solution at 25 °C.

Moles of NaOH mass/molar mass of NaOH 7.4/40.0 0.185 mol [OH-] [NaOH]moles/volume 0.185/0.100 1.85 M pOH-log[OH-]log(1.85)0.2
